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Eastham Rake to Welshpool start from as little as £9.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Eastham Rake to Welshpool are available for £30.70 one way

Facilities and Amenities

For those planning their journey from Eastham Rake, it is essential to note that there is no ticket office on site. However, smartcards can be issued and validated here, and tickets purchased online can be collected. While there are no waiting rooms or accessible tickets, the station is equipped with induction loops for the hearing impaired and customer help points for guidance. CCTV surveillance ensures customer security throughout the day.

Accessibility at Eastham Rake is somewhat limited, with step-free access available partially. Although there is an 84 meter ramp for the Hooton-bound platform, the Liverpool-bound platform requires use of stepped ramps. Facilities like toilets and a seating area are available; and though there is no provision for wheelchair loans or waiting lounges, passengers still find comfort in the basic amenities provided.

Onward Travel Connections

Though a taxi rank is absent at the station, travelers won’t find themselves stranded as there are several bus links available. The nearest airport is Liverpool John Lennon Airport, with integrated bus and rail tickets purchasable from any Merseyrail station. The local bus services can be accessed by contacting the Traveline. Rail replacement services are also available during planned disruptions ensuring passengers can continue their journeys with minimal hassle.

Facilities and Services

Welshpool station ensures that your journey is smooth and convenient. While it doesn’t boast a ticket office, rest assured that tickets can be collected from the easily accessible machines — these machines, however, do not accept cash so make sure to have your major debit or credit card handy. Moreover, the local Tourist Information Centre offers an alternative spot for purchasing rail tickets.

Accessibility is a priority here, with step-free access available for trains headed in both directions — Shrewsbury and Aberystwyth/Pwllheli. The station provides an induction loop and ramps for train access, although facilities for luggage storage, waiting rooms, and accessible toilets are not available. Parking is readily available with 23 spaces, including two dedicated to accessible parking — and it’s free, which means no hunting for change or worrying about running back to feed a meter.

Onward Travel Connections

Getting around from Welshpool is a breeze, thanks to its well-connected transport links. For those moments when a train is unavailable, thanks to a convenient rail replacement service and nearby bus stops located approximately 650 meters away on Severn Road, there are solid transit options. Although bicycle hire isn’t available at the station, the town itself offers other local options should you wish to explore the scenic Welsh countryside on two wheels.
